产铀花岗岩体中的晶质铀矿的若干特征——以粤北石人嶂钨矿为例

    Some characteristics of ulrichile in granite The wolframite of——Shirenzhang in north of Guangdong as an example

    • 摘要: 粤北地区是中国花岗岩型铀矿最为重要的大型矿集区,在开展花岗岩型晶质铀矿的一般矿物学特征、矿物组合特点、产状及成因等方面进行综述的基础上,粤北石人嶂钨矿晶质铀矿的检测研究,发现晶质铀矿经常与磁铁矿、钛铁矿、黄铁矿、独居石、错石、磷灰石、磷钇矿等副矿物共生。在副矿物为钛铁矿-独居石型花岗岩中,晶质铀矿含量较高;晶质铀矿产出在矿物粒间、裂隙以及矿物的边缘。晶质铀矿的形态、含量、成因与地质条件关系的深入研究,必将为寻找晶质铀矿提供帮助。

       

      Abstract: The northern Guangdong is the most important large concentration uranium area with granite,in the summary of the characteristics of general mineralogy 、mineral combination、occurrence and causes,and in the research of ulrichile with detecting in north of Guangdong,it found that ulrichile often symbiotic with the deputy minerals of magnetite、ilmenite、pyrite、monazite、apatite、Xenotime and so on.The contents of urichile is higher in the graite of ilmenite-monazite; The ulrichile growth in intergranular、fissures and the edge of mineral.The deeply research of relation,which between the urichile of form、content、causes and geological conditions,all that will provide help for search ulrichile.
